Description

Tetrahydroprotoberberine is a key intermediate and reference standard belonging to the protoberberine class of alkaloids. This compound is of significant interest in pharmaceutical research and development due to its structural relationship to bioactive natural products. It serves as a critical building block for the synthesis of more complex alkaloids and is utilized in biochemical and pharmacological studies. Basic Information

Product Name Tetrahydroprotoberberine
CAS No. 483-49-8
Molecular Formula C20H21NO4
Molecular Weight 339.39 g/mol
Synonyms Canadine; (S)-Canadine; Tetrahydroberberine; 5,6,13,13a-Tetrahydro-8,9-dimethoxy[1,3]dioxolo[4,5-g]isoquinolino[3,2-a]isoquinoline; 9,10-Dimethoxy-5,6-dihydro-[1,3]dioxolo[4,5-g]isoquinolino[3,2-a]isoquinoline; NSC 172925; THPB
EINECS 207-599-6

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store in a cool, dry, and well-ventilated place at a controlled room temperature (15-25°C). This product is hygroscopic (moisture-sensitive); ensure the container is sealed tightly after each use to prevent degradation from atmospheric moisture.
